Highlights
Are people in Roseville older or younger than people in Ione?
- The Median Age in Roseville is 6.9 years younger than in Ione.

Are housing costs cheaper in Roseville or Ione?
- Roseville housing costs are 36.6% more expensive than Ione hous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Roseville or Ione?
- The average commute for residents of Roseville is 6.2 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Ione.

Things to do in Ione?
Living in Ione, CA is a unique experience. The city is located in Amador County and provides a rural atmosphere full of charm and beauty. Residents enjoy outdoor recreational activities, such as biking and hiking, with nature trails throughout the area. There are also numerous small businesses that line Main Street and provide locals with shopping and dining options. Many of the homes in the city have their own distinctive character, giving it an old-fashioned vibe. The people who live here are friendly and welcoming, making it easy for newcomers to settle in quickly. With its close proximity to the Sierra Nevadas and Lake Camanche, Ione is a great place for anyone looking to experience relaxed living with some amazing views.

Things to do in Roseville?
Roseville, California is a vibrant city located northeast of Sacramento. Here visitors and locals alike can find plenty to do from exploring the historic downtown area or taking part in one of many festivals held throughout the year. With its excellent schools, thriving businesses, and plenty of recreational opportunities it's no wonder why so many people choose to make Roseville their home. There are also numerous dining options, shopping centers and entertainment venues available for those looking for some fun!
